  2. Malta - Protection against particular hazards - Regulation, Decree, Ordinance

    Protection of Workers from the Risks related to Exposure to Asbestos at Work Regulations (L.N. 323 of 2006) (S.L. 424.23). - Regulations on-line

    Adoption: 2006-12-16 | MLT-2006-R-75361

    Provides protection of workers against risks arising from exposure to asbestos at work, including assessmens of risks, notification, prohibition by means of spraying, measurements, limit value, work plan, personal protective equipment, record keeping, medical surveillance, etc.

  3. Malta - Protection against particular hazards - Regulation, Decree, Ordinance

    Work Place (Minimum Health and Safety Requirements for the Protection of Workers from Risks resulting from Exposure to Noise) Regulations (L.N. No. 158 of 2006) (S.L. 424.28). - Regulations on-line

    Adoption: 2006-07-28 | Date of entry into force: 2006-07-28 | Date of partial entry into force: 2011-02-05 | Date of partial entry into force: 2008-02-05 | MLT-2006-R-75360

    Provides minimum requirements for the protection of workers against noise, including: exposure limits, assessments of risks, elimination or minimizing the risks, personal protective equipment, information, training, consulation and participatio of workers, health surveillance and record keeping.

  6. Malta - Protection against particular hazards - Regulation, Decree, Ordinance

    Work Place (Minimum Health and Safety Requirements for the Protection of Workers from Risks arising from exposure to Noise) Regulations, 2004 (Legal Notice 185 of 2004). - Legal Notice No. 185 of 2004

    Adoption: 2004-04 | MLT-2004-R-69296

    Made in accordance with Occupational Health and Safety Authority Act (Cap. 424). Sets forth how noise levels at work should be assessed and provides general instructions on limiting the negative effects of exposure to noise at work such as the provision of ear protectors, hearing checks, information and training. The employer is required to take measures to reduce the risks such as controlling noise at source.

  11. Malta - Protection against particular hazards - Regulation, Decree, Ordinance

    Protection of Workers from the Risks related to Exposure to Carcinogens or Mutagens at Work Regulations (Legal Notice No. 122 of 2003) (S.L. 424.22). - Legislation on-line

    Adoption: 2003-05-16 | MLT-2003-R-69302

    Made in accordance with the Occupational Health and Safety Authority Act (Cap. 424). Sets forth the procedures to be followed by workers and employers to limit exposure to carcinogens or mutagens such as protection from exposure, health surveillance, risk assessment and training. Also provides lists of substances (Schedule I) and daily limit values (Schedule III).
